This video highlights the impressive performance of DoubleTap ammunition, particularly its hard-cast bullets and full copper hollow points, when tested in ballistic gel. The presenter notes that DoubleTap ammo has been used in carry guns for years and was amazed by its penetration capabilities, with one load blowing through 16 inches of gel and another penetrating 15 inches. The ammunition is deemed highly suitable for self-defense applications with small revolvers.
This video critically evaluates Winchester Silvertip ammunition, particularly for self-defense. The speaker, demonstrating high expertise through independent testing, highlights a critical failure mode: the hollow point becoming clogged by fabric barriers, preventing expansion. This renders the round ineffective, behaving like a Full Metal Jacket. The video contrasts this with Defiant Munitions' Full Copper Hollow Point, which reliably expands even after passing through cloth. The speaker strongly advises against Winchester Silvertip for self-defense and encourages viewers to test their own carry ammunition.
